The 8th Grade Punchers have been hard at it in the past couple of weeks. After coming off a third place tournament win in Llano, the Punchers hosted their own Invitational with Llano, Nueces Canyon, and Junction with four divisions.

In the 8th Boys division, Junction took on Llano in game one and advanced after a 32-12 win. The Punchers then played Nueces Canyon and fell short of a win by the score 30-33. Mason then took on Llano in their next game, defeating Llano 33-15. Junction and Nueces Canyon played for the championship with Nueces Canyon winning by a margin of 37-23.

The Punchers then hit the road to take on Irion County in Mertzon Jan. 25.

Mason jumped to an early lead in the first quarter scoring eleven, then tacked on another five before the break. By the end of period three the Punchers lead 26-17. Good defense by the Punchers finished out the game holding I.C. to only three points in the final stanza.
